Refined Energy Corp. Approves Dufferin Project Drill Program

RUU · Price

Executive Summary

  • Refined Energy Corp. received approval from Eagle Plains Resources Ltd. to commence a Phase I drill program on the Dufferin West property, with field work slated for Q1 2026.
  • The initial program comprises ground‑based gravity and electromagnetic surveys plus three drill holes (~1,200 m total) targeting two conductors, with an estimated budget of ≈ $1.7 million.
  • Refined has made the first payment to Eagle Plains and is securing contractors; the program may be expanded as results dictate.

Key Details

  • Program Approval: Eagle Plains Resources Ltd. approved the proposed drill program; Refined Energy Corp. executed the initial payment.
  • Scope – Phase I:
  • Ground‑based gravity survey
  • Electromagnetic (EM) survey
  • Three drill holes totaling ~1,200 m to test two distinct conductors on the Dufferin West property.
  • Budget: Approximate initial budget of $1.7 million, subject to adjustment based on timing, progress, and results.
  • Timeline: Drilling planned for the first quarter of 2026 to take advantage of optimal winter conditions.
  • Expansion Potential: Program structure allows for additional drilling and target generation as data from Phase I become available.
  • Management Quote: CEO Mark Fields said the approved program positions Refined “to undertake the drill program in Q1 2026 and capitalize on optimal winter conditions,” highlighting it as a maiden drill effort for the company in the Athabasca Basin.
  • Qualified Person: C. C. (Chuck) Downie, P.Geo., director of Eagle Plains, reviewed and approved the scientific and technical disclosure per NI 43‑101 standards.
